Visitors, parents, students and teachers were treated to a delightful musical interlude at the Awards Ceremony on Friday morning, 25th October. Katie McCrea sang "Se tu m'ami". Mr. Missenelli played a trumpet solo from "Showboat". Andrew Enright played an original piece of music on piano. Look at the 2013-2014 Gallery to see photos from the Ceremony.
